Applied AI
AI is useful when it has a clear job.
Every Vaylo AI assistant has a defined task, defined inputs, and a defined place where a person reviews or controls the outcome.
Lead qualification assistant
Scores new leads against criteria you define and can read.
Uses: Form answers, source, service area, and stated timeline.
Human control: Borderline scores are flagged for human review; overrides are logged.
Follow-up drafting & approval
Drafts personalized email and SMS follow-up in your voice.
Uses: The contact's record, consent status, and conversation history.
Human control: Drafts wait in an approval queue — nothing sends on its own unless you configure it to.
Conversation & call summaries
Summarizes calls, threads, and long histories into next steps.
Uses: Recorded activity on the customer record.
Human control: Summaries cite the events they used; people verify before acting.
Next-best-action recommendations
Suggests the most useful next step on an opportunity.
Uses: Stage, activity recency, and your playbook rules.
Human control: Recommendations are suggestions in the owner's queue, never silent actions.
Dormant lead reactivation
Finds cold leads worth another look and drafts the re-opener.
Uses: Last activity, past interest, and consent status.
Human control: A person approves the list and the message before anything goes out.
Pipeline exception monitoring
Watches for stalled deals, missed follow-ups, and broken handoffs.
Uses: Stage age, task status, and activity gaps.
Human control: Exceptions surface to owners and managers as alerts, not automatic changes.
Final automation designs depend on your data, policies, and risk requirements — defined together during discovery.

Bring your own providers
Your providers. Your accounts. One clear operating layer.
Connect the AI, phone, messaging, email, calendar, payment, and data services you already trust. You keep the provider relationship and pay the provider directly; Vaylo coordinates the workflow.
Paste a secure API key
For providers such as Claude, Twilio, Telnyx, Resend, or ElevenLabs. Keys are encrypted server-side, validated with a low-risk test, and never shown again after saving.
Connect with OAuth
For providers such as Google Workspace, Microsoft 365, RingCentral, Calendly, Stripe, HighLevel, HubSpot, or Salesforce. You sign in at the provider and approve exact scopes.
Request a custom adapter
For an approved provider that isn't yet certified. We scope the connector against Vaylo's adapter contract rather than faking support.
Some providers require a specific plan, sender registration, app review, admin consent, or vendor approval — each catalog entry states its real availability. Browse the provider catalog or see connection security.
